Job Description

Cargo Equipment Agent



Date: 29 Jan 2025 City: Sharjah

Area of Responsibility



• Freight Centre

Purpose of the Job



The purpose of this role is to carry out a full range of cargo handling activities as a member of a cargo team in order to affect the safe and timely turnaround of allocated customer airline flights.

Key Responsibilities



• To collect, transport and manually load all cargo shipment and allocated freight onto a range of different types of customer aircraft in order to affect the timely turnaround of allocated flights in line with agreed procedures and health and safety regulations.
• Offloading Cargo at the acceptance area
• Delivering Cargo to the aircraft stands
• Delivering cargo to customers
• Truck loading
• Cargo build ups and breakdowns
• To operate, truck dock, lower able stations,
• Checking of PDY's and BTR's if they are serviceable or not
• To carry out daily operator checks and operate all vehicles and ramp equipment used during turnaround, according to current standards and procedures, so as to minimize risk of injury to self and others and damage to customer aircraft.
• To carry out a range of other cargo duties, as delegated by the Team Leader, during the offload and loading in accordance with agreed procedures and customer service level agreements, to ensure the safe and timely turnaround of aircraft.
• To demonstrate a high standard of behavior, appearance and timekeeping in compliance with Company codes and standards of conduct, so as to demonstrate professionalism with an inherent respect of colleagues, customer airlines and passengers.
